
Men's Soccer Opens Season Against Memphis
August 24, 2006 | Men's Soccer
Aug. 24, 2006
Louisville, Ky. - The Louisville men's soccer team will open the season Friday night in a game against the Memphis Tigers in Cardinal Park at 7:00 p.m.
The Cardinals exhibition play with 0-0-2 record with scoreless ties against Evansville and UAB. They return last year's leading scorers Frank Jonke and David Guzman. Guzman earned first team preseason All-BIG EAST honors.
The Cardinal defense has been strong in the two exhibition games. Goalie David Simolike registered two shutouts against Evansville and the UAB in his first year of play at U of L.
Memphis comes into the game with a 1-0-1 record in exhibition play. The Tigers defeated Lipscomb 2-0 and ended with a 1-1 tie against Christian Brothers College. Memphis returns six starters from last year's team. Their defense includes three-year starting defender Michael Coburn and goalkeeper Tyler Strom.
